    About the Book

    Edit

    The best way to describe this book is: a detailed journey to much that is around us. My style in photography is one where the image is not captured just for the sake of remembering the place, rather images are captured to evoke the passion and the meaning of the subject; whether it's a flower, a car or a fountain.

    Pictures are rarely cropped for effect. Here, of the 52 images only 2 are cropped. Everything was framed as you see it.

    About the Creator
    mlizzola
    Massimo Lizzola
    Canada

    I have been taking photographs since the early 80's. Back then it was with a 35mm Olympus. As the decades passed, I continued to develop my eye and ability for the details. These days it's very easy to 'capture and delete'. But doing that, one does not learn anything. I take images to show a place, a detail, person or event are not taken lightly. The image has to mean something. I much prefer taking time to frame, focus (depth, format, aspect ratio, what is not in focus) then shooting a lot. Equipment has changed from 35mm film to digital. Although I used many digital cameras; My current SLR is the Nikon D7100.
